Elderly with decreased memory/ vision

By: CathyM [2-December-13 1:33AM]
posts
No picture yet!

I would really like to see an easier sudoku puzzle book ( 4x4, 6x6) in large print, to offer to my father and my father-in-law, who both have limited ability to attend to a task for a long enough period to complete even an easy 9 block sudoku. It would be great to see them have success at a puzzle, but not have it be called a "children's" puzzle. They need large print due to poor vision.
I think this type of puzzle would be a huge blessing in many assisted living settings where we see a lot of declining cognition, but folks are still able to complete smaller tasks and need to have successful completion to keep them going.
